Next Release Originally, we had plans for our next release to be an EP titled 'When You Carry A Hammer, Everything Looks Like A Nail'. As it has turned out, over the last couple of months we've written enough new material for an album, so we're going to go for that instead. It'll be called 'Siafu' and is almost completely written. There will be five tracks, all inspired by the life-cycle of african killer ants! Expect this sometime around September this year, and you've guessed it...House of Stairs will be the label releasing it. Back in Black? Click here to read it. 25 September 2003 Arm Yourself with Clairvoyance Our debut album 'Arm Yourself With Clairvoyance' is released Oct 6th on House of Stairs. Visit the label's website at www.houseofstairs.co.uk where you can listen to the entire album and download a couple of mp3s. The Combined Stupidity of Spiteful Men Our next release will be a split album with our friends American Heritage and Art of Burning Water called 'The Combined Stupidity of Spiteful Men'. Our contribution is a 10 minute piece called 'Myrmidon'. In support of this release and our debut album, we're touring the UK with those two bands during October.
